What is Blast Inu (BLAST)?

Blast Inu (BLAST) describes itself as the first 0/0 community memecoin Inu specifically designed for the Blast Layer-2 (L2) network. In the cryptocurrency world, “memecoin” refers to a cryptocurrency that gains popularity primarily through internet memes and social media virality, rather than being based on a sophisticated technical foundation or real-world utility. The “Inu” suffix, inspired by the Shiba Inu dog breed, is a common trope in this space. Blast Inu aims to leverage the popularity of memecoins while being natively integrated with the Blast L2 platform. The “0/0” descriptor may be a reference to taxes or fees, suggesting a zero-tax structure on transactions within the Blast Inu ecosystem, aiming to incentivize trading and community participation.

How Do You Buy Blast Inu (BLAST)?

Purchasing Blast Inu requires a few essential steps. Firstly, you’ll need a cryptocurrency wallet compatible with the Blast network. Secondly, you will likely need to acquire some ETH or other tokens on the Blast L2 chain to trade for Blast Inu. Once you have ETH or other accepted token in your Blast compatible wallet, you can access a decentralized exchange (DEX) that lists Blast Inu. This typically involves connecting your wallet to the DEX, searching for the BLAST trading pair (e.g., BLAST/ETH), and executing a swap. Ensure you are using a reputable DEX and verifying the contract address of BLAST to avoid scams. Possible exchanges that may list Blast Inu include decentralized exchanges (DEXs) that operate on the Blast L2 network, such as Thruster, and possibly centralized exchanges, like KuCoin.

How Do You Store Blast Inu (BLAST)?

Storing Blast Inu securely is crucial to protect your investment. The most common method is to use a cryptocurrency wallet that supports the Blast network. There are two main types of wallets:

  • Software Wallets (Hot Wallets): These are applications that you can download and install on your computer or mobile device. Software wallets are convenient for accessing your tokens quickly, but they are more vulnerable to security risks compared to hardware wallets. Examples include:
    • MetaMask: A popular browser extension and mobile app that supports multiple Ethereum-compatible networks, including Blast.
    • Trust Wallet: A mobile wallet that sup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ies and blockchain networks.
  • Hardware Wallets (Cold Wallets): These are physical devices that store your private keys offline, providing a higher level of security. Hardware wallets are ideal for storing large amounts of cryptocurrency or for long-term holding. Examples include:
    • Ledger Nano S/X: Popular hardware wallets that support a wide range of cryptocurrencies and can be used to interact with the Blast network through MetaMask or other compatible software wallets.
    • Trezor: Another well-known hardware wallet that offers similar functionality to Ledger devices.

When choosing a wallet, consider the balance between convenience and security. Software wallets are suitable for everyday use and smaller amounts, while hardware wallets are recommended for storing larger holdings securely.
